RAM mounts are very good. Been using them for years in the boat business for GPS/Fishfinder stuff.
 
I would go with nothing less than RAM. Use them in the aircraft industry and they are the best out there.

Yea, it's looking like the best choice as I browse around. I really like how it grabs the laptop at four points. A lot of the cheapo brands use a strap across the laptop and that just won't cut the mustard with me.
 
You'll want something to support the screen too if you intend to drive with it open. Hinges on laptops tend to not like all the bouncing around that goes on in a car. (note that it is illegal to be able to see the screen when driving in many states)
